Market Sizing, Growth Estimates, and CAGR Projections

Based on current industry data, the South Korea Bag Tipping Stations market was valued at approximately USD 150 million in 2023. This valuation considers the widespread adoption of automated bag handling in retail, logistics, and waste management sectors. Projecting forward, the market is expected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.5% over the next five years, reaching an estimated USD 245 million by 2028.

Assumptions underpinning these projections include:

  • Continued urbanization and e-commerce growth fueling demand for efficient packaging solutions.
  • Government initiatives promoting sustainable waste management and recycling infrastructure.
  • Technological advancements reducing system costs and enhancing operational efficiency.
  • Increasing adoption of digital and IoT-enabled tipping stations for real-time monitoring and maintenance.

Value Chain Analysis: From Raw Materials to Lifecycle Services

Raw Material Sourcing

– Steel, aluminum, and durable plastics form the core structural components. – Electronic components, sensors, and IoT modules sourced from global suppliers. – Sustainable sourcing practices are increasingly prioritized to align with environmental standards.

Manufacturing & Assembly

– Modular manufacturing facilities enable scalable production. – Emphasis on quality control, safety certifications, and compliance with South Korean standards (e.g., KC certification).

Distribution & Deployment

– Direct sales through OEM channels or via authorized distributors. – Installation often involves integration with existing logistics or waste management infrastructure. – After-sales services include maintenance, software updates, and lifecycle upgrades.

Revenue Models & Lifecycle Services

– Upfront sales of hardware systems. – Subscription-based models for software, IoT data analytics, and remote monitoring. – Lifecycle services generating recurring revenue through maintenance, spare parts, and system upgrades. – End-of-life recycling and refurbishment programs to maximize asset utilization.

Cost Structures, Pricing Strategies, and Investment Patterns

Cost components include:

  • Raw materials (~40%), with fluctuations influenced by global supply chains.
  • Manufacturing (~25%), including labor, automation, and quality assurance.
  • R&D (~10%), especially for smart and IoT-enabled systems.
  • Distribution & installation (~15%).
  • After-sales & lifecycle services (~10%).

Pricing strategies focus on value-based pricing for advanced, IoT-enabled stations, with tiered offerings catering to different throughput and automation needs. Capital investment patterns favor scalable, modular systems, with increasing preference for subscription and leasing models to reduce upfront costs.
